The Science of Zombie Salmon: Decoding the Secrets of the Undead Fish

Understanding the Basics of Zombie Salmon

Zombie salmon is a term that describes salmon in the final stages of their life cycle. After spawning, these fish return to their birth rivers, often appearing battered, decayed, and still moving—hence the "zombie" moniker. This phenomenon is common in Pacific salmon species like Chinook, Sockeye, and Coho. The journey back to their spawning grounds is arduous, causing severe physical deterioration due to stress, energy depletion, and environmental challenges.

The Science Behind Zombie Salmon

The life cycle of salmon is a marvel of nature, involving an epic migration from freshwater streams where they are born, to the ocean where they grow, and back to their natal streams to spawn. This journey can cover thousands of miles. Once they reach their spawning grounds, they use their remaining energy to reproduce, often battling upstream currents and predators. After spawning, their bodies enter a rapid state of decay. The physiological changes during this period include the breakdown of body tissues and the development of grotesque appearances.

The science behind this phenomenon lies in the biological imperative of salmon to reproduce at all costs. During their migration, they cease feeding and rely on stored energy reserves. This energy is prioritized for the journey and reproduction, leaving nothing for post-spawning survival. Consequently, their immune systems weaken, making them susceptible to infections and diseases. Additionally, their skin and flesh deteriorate, further contributing to their "zombie" appearance.

Ecological Impact of Zombie Salmon

Zombie salmon play a crucial role in their ecosystems. Their decaying bodies provide a significant nutrient source for aquatic and terrestrial environments. The nutrients released from their decomposing bodies fertilize streams and forests, supporting the growth of plants and the health of entire ecosystems. This nutrient input is essential for the productivity of these environments, affecting everything from microorganisms to large mammals like bears and eagles.

Moreover, the presence of zombie salmon influences the behavior and distribution of various species. For instance, bears often prefer these weakened fish as they are easier to catch, which can lead to concentrated feeding areas and impact the local flora and fauna dynamics. The nutrient cycling facilitated by zombie salmon is vital for the long-term health and sustainability of their habitats.

Health and Food Safety Concerns

One common concern among consumers is whether zombie salmon are safe to eat. Given their deteriorated state and the high levels of toxins and pathogens that accumulate in their bodies during the spawning phase, these fish are generally not suitable for consumption. The flesh of zombie salmon is often mushy, discolored, and off-flavored, making it unappetizing and potentially harmful.

Regulatory agencies and health organizations typically advise against eating salmon that have reached this stage of their life cycle. Instead, they recommend focusing on fresh, healthy fish harvested during their prime. Understanding the life cycle and health status of salmon helps consumers make informed choices and supports sustainable fishing practices.

Conservation and Sustainable Practices

The phenomenon of zombie salmon underscores the importance of conservation efforts to protect salmon habitats and support healthy populations. Human activities such as dam construction, pollution, and overfishing have significantly impacted salmon populations worldwide. To ensure the survival of these remarkable fish, it is essential to implement and support conservation measures.

Efforts to restore natural river flows, improve water quality, and protect spawning grounds are crucial for the long-term sustainability of salmon populations. Additionally, promoting responsible fishing practices and raising public awareness about the importance of salmon in ecosystems can contribute to their conservation. By understanding and appreciating the life cycle of salmon, including the phenomenon of zombie salmon, we can take meaningful actions to protect these vital species and their habitats.
